Brazil eVisa Processing Time 2026 – How Long Does It Take?

The official Brazil eVisa processing time is up to 5 business days. In practice, many applications are approved within 1-3 business days. However, processing times can vary based on application volume, document completeness, and time of year. This guide explains what to expect and how to plan your application timeline.

Official Processing Times

Stage Time
Application submission to first review Same day to 24 hours
Document review process 1-3 business days
Final decision (approved / rejected) Up to 5 business days total
Approval email delivery Within minutes of decision

Business days are Monday to Friday, excluding Brazilian public holidays. Weekends do not count toward processing time.

How Early Should You Apply?

We strongly recommend applying at least 2 weeks (14 days) before departure. This provides:

  • 5 business days for normal processing
  • Additional time if additional documents are requested
  • Time to re-apply if the initial application is rejected
  • Buffer for unexpected delays during peak travel seasons

During holiday periods (December-January, July-August, Carnival), extend to 3-4 weeks to account for higher application volumes.

Factors That Affect Processing Time

Application Completeness

Incomplete or unclear documents trigger a “request for additional information,” adding 3-5 more business days. Submit a complete, error-free application to avoid delays. See our Brazil eVisa Requirements checklist.

Application Volume

During peak travel periods, processing times may extend closer to the 5-business-day limit. Apply early during busy seasons.

Document Quality

Blurry scans or incorrectly sized photos slow processing. Ensure all documents are clear, correctly formatted, and within file size limits.

How to Track Your Application

  1. Online portal: Log into brazil.vfsevisa.com, go to “My Applications” to see current status.
  2. Email updates: VFS Global sends automatic notifications at key stages.

Status labels: Submitted, Under Review, Additional Documents Required, Approved, Rejected.

If Processing Takes Longer Than 5 Business Days

  1. Check for “Additional Documents Required” notifications in your portal account
  2. Contact VFS Global support through the portal with your application reference number
  3. If travel is within 48 hours, contact the nearest Brazilian consulate directly

Do not submit a duplicate application while waiting – this can cause complications with both applications.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can the Brazil eVisa be processed in 24 hours?

While some applications are approved within 24 hours, this is not guaranteed. The official processing time is up to 5 business days. Do not rely on same-day processing.

Does processing time include weekends?

No. Processing time is measured in business days (Monday-Friday), excluding Brazilian public holidays.

Does submitting additional documents restart the timer?

Yes. When you re-submit after a request for additional documents, the review clock effectively resets. Expect up to 5 more business days from the re-submission date.
